pi network grace period update
In a significant development, the first deadline of the Grace Period for submitting Know Your Customer (KYC) applications has been extended to November 30, 2024. This extension gives Pioneers more time to complete KYC, while the final deadline for Mainnet migration remains unchanged on December 31, 2024. Be sure to meet these deadlines to avoid forfeiting most of your past Pi balance, other than Pi mined within the rolling window of the last 6 months before your Pi is migrated.

Pi Network has unveiled a major update to its Grace Period algorithms, focusing on refining how timer pauses are managed during system blocks. Previously, timers might have paused unnecessarily due to system blocks, which could disrupt mining activities and cause confusion among Pioneers. With the new algorithm enhancements, the timer will now pause more accurately, only doing so when actual system blocks occur. This adjustment is intended to reduce unwarranted pauses and ensure more reliable tracking of mining progress.
Accurate timer management is vital for an efficient mining experience. The update to Grace Period algorithms promises fewer disruptions and a smoother mining process for Pioneers. By reducing unnecessary pauses, Pi Network aims to improve overall productivity and ensure that mining efforts are properly recorded.
To further support its Pioneers, Pi Network has introduced a new feature that allows users to report issues directly when working on the Mainnet Checklist. If a Pioneer encounters difficulties while the timer is active, they can now click on the “I need help with my checklist completion” link. This feature provides a straightforward way to report specific steps where issues are being faced, facilitating quicker support and resolution.
This new feature is designed to streamline the support process and minimize delays, allowing Pioneers to continue their mining activities with fewer interruptions.
